THE SHADOW WAR AGAINST HITLER: The Covert Operations of America's Wartime Secret Intelligence Service, Christof Mauch, Jeremiah M. Riemer, trans., Columbia University Press, New York, 2003, 333 pages, $34.50.
Christ of Mauch's The Shadow War Against Hitler: The Covert Operations of America's Wartime Secret Intelligence Service describes the development of the Coordinator of Information (COI); its successor, the Office of Strategic Services (OSS); and their activities du...
